About the opportunity:

Provides supplies, equipment and assistance to the anesthesiologists for the safe and efficient administration of anesthesia to the surgical patient. Stocks anesthesia carts and maintains anesthesia equipment. Stocks and maintains OR rooms, cupboards and carts. Helps in transport of patients and turnover of OR rooms between cases. Functions as a member of the Surgical Team.

 
What you will do:
  1. Clean, restock and maintain all anesthesia equipment and supplies.
  2. Ensure anesthesia machines are in the surgical suites.
  3. Add specialty equipment and supplies to anesthesia set ups as requested.
  4. Clean, restock and maintain OR rooms, cupboards and drawers.
  5. Transports patients to and from the OR.
  6. Helps in turnover of OR rooms between cases.
  7. Reports all safety hazards that could harm patients, visitors or other hospital employees to appropriate personnel.
  8. Collaborates with Materials Management in ordering and inventory of anesthesia supplies.
  9. Assists with general clean up in Operating Room.
  10. Participates in Vail Health and VVSC Quality Improvement Programs including confidential occurrence reporting.
  11. Role model the principals of a Just Culture and Organizational Values.
  12. Perform other duties as assigned. Must be HIPAA compliant.
